Kessler Pond Clean Up and Brush Removal (Phase 1)

  • June 26, 2021
  • 8:00 AM - 12:00 PM

You are invited to participate in the first phase of a new initiative to clean up and restore North Terrace Lake (it’s the pond in Kessler Park off Chestnut Trafficway underneath the Lexington Ave bridge). Ultimately the initiative’s goal is to have an infrastructure around the pond repaired and/or improved as it’s its in dire need of assistance. This initiative was started and is still being worked on, by a eleven-year-old named Jack. Jack wants to see this pond improved so that future generations can enjoy this fantastic part of Kessler Park!

To start this project off we first need to clean up the trash in the area. We also need to remove the brush on the south side of the pond which has been blocking access for a number of years. This will allow work to be done on these areas and allow for a better inventory of the pond infrastructure on the north shore. This is where we need your help on Saturday, June 26th, 2021. Please come out, anything that you are willing to do is much needed and appreciated! We look forward to seeing you all out here on the 26th of this month.

KCP&R will be providing loppers, trash bags, and trucks to haul away brush and trash.

Please bring gloves, water, and any of your favorite brush removal tools!
